In Dan's Words: This is a W2 steel blade. It has a long riccasso so the user can place their index finger closer to the blade. The riccasso has filing to add some feel when using the knife with the index finger hugging the riccasso  The tang is hidden but it is wide and extends to within an inch or less of the handle. The spacers are black phenolic pieces glued up and pressed with alternating maple pieces. (I was into making long bows at one time and since I had these bow laminations decided to make a bunch of pieces for knife handles - a bow hunter would probably recognize them). This ebony is the most stable ebony that highly resists checking. I suggest using black shoe polish on the handle to keep it in good shape. Black shoe polish is a mix of wax and mineral oil and works great on these really hard woods. Ebony is at the top of the scale for wood hardness. This is Gaboon Ebony (the best in my opinion).

 

Blade Length: 4.5" (115mm)

Cutting Edge Length: 3.75" (95mm)

Overall Length: 8.85" (225mm)

Weight: 5.4 oz (152 grams)

Dan Petersen is a American Bladesmith Society recognized Master Smith, creating one of a kind custom knives in his workshop in Kansas. Petersen started making knives in 1981, and earned his ABS Master Smith rank in 1989. He has one numerous knife making awards and his knives have been featured on the cover of Blade Magazine. He is passionate about metallurgy, takes careful attention in the heat treatment process, and is inspired by the knives of American history, bowies, hunters, and fighters.
